Darwinism, Design, and Public Education
Edited By: John Angus Campbell and Stephen C. Meyer
Publisher: Michigan State University Press
This podcast provides a short review of this balanced volume which contains essays by both supporters and critics debating intelligent design and whether design should be allowed in public school science classes. The scholars approach the question from the standpoints of constitutional law, philosophy, rhetoric, education, and science. Visit the website at www.darwinanddesign.com
